Alvin W. Lo is a scholar working on Endocrinology, Molecular Medicine and Molecular Biology. According to data from OpenAlex, Alvin W. Lo has authored 33 papers receiving a total of 840 ind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 15 papers in Endocrinology, 11 papers in Molecular Medicine and 10 papers in Molecular Biology. Recurrent topics in Alvin W. Lo's work include Escherichia coli research studies (15 papers), Antibiotic Resistance in Bacteria (11 papers) and Bacterial Genetics and Biotechnology (7 papers). Alvin W. Lo is often cited by papers focused on Escherichia coli research studies (15 papers), Antibiotic Resistance in Bacteria (11 papers) and Bacterial Genetics and Biotechnology (7 papers). Alvin W. Lo collaborates with scholars based in Australia, United Kingdom and Belgium. Alvin W. Lo's co-authors include Mark A. Schembri, Scott A. Beatson, Minh‐Duy Phan, Han Remaut, Eric C. Reynolds, Christine A. Seers, Danilo Gomes Moriel, Glen C. Ulett, Nada Slakeski and Kate M. Peters and has published in prestigious journals such as Proceedings of the National Academy of Sciences, Journal of Biological Chemistry and Nature Communications.
